This install was/is pretty straightforward, truly plug-n-play. There's this ridge on the Lutz connector that should have been trimmed off before it was shipped to me but Bryan from Lutz is quick to reply and told me that he was sorry about that, it should've have been shaved off prior to being shipped to me. No biggie, I got my trusted razor blade and trimmed. Calibration is pretty straightforward, 1 click up corrects you .5%, I was off by 5% so I had to click it 10 times. Took it for a spin and verified that the car's speed reading matched the GPS reading. Came back to the house and secured the unit with some RTV to protect it from the elements and secured it with the supplied zip-ties so it's out of the way.
